DOWNINGTOWN — Over 40 educators and coaches, along with 25 students and 12 sponsors, gathered on Monday, June 2, for the inaugural Pennsylvania Scholastic Esports League (PSEL) Esports Expo at the Chester County Intermediate Unit (CCIU). The event featured a Rocket League tournament and offered a full day of exploration into the dynamic world of scholastic esports.
The event provided participants with opportunities to witness competitive gameplay, explore cutting-edge esports solutions, and build valuable connections in the esports education space. The tournament ran bracket style with top teams competing in the final competition.
“We were thrilled to welcome so many of our scholastic esports colleagues from Pennsylvania and beyond to our first PSEL Esports Expo,” said Kammas Kersch, director of the PSEL Esports League. “As an educator-led league, it is important to us to continue to foster learning opportunities for both students and educators. One of the highlights of the day was getting to spend time networking with our PSEL community!”
Kersch, who is also the CCIU STEM services coordinator, opened the event with a welcome and introduction that focused on key pillars for setting up an esports program in schools.
Several sponsors hosted engaging spotlight sessions designed specifically for educators, offering valuable insights, tools, and resources to help support successful scholastic esports teams.
The Rocket League finals saw an exciting playoff between West Chester Henderson High School and Chichester High School, with both teams showcasing impressive skill and teamwork. In a thrilling finish, Henderson High School emerged as the tournament champions.
Matt Swan, CCIU STEM innovation specialist, emphasized, “The Rocket League matches were full of great highlight plays, and in the end West Chester Henderson walked away as the champions without losing a single game!”
Swan continued, “We want to congratulate the players from West Chester Henderson on their phenomenal performance and also recognize the players from Chichester High School & 21st Century Cyber Charter School. We look forward to our next chance to showcase the skills of these amazing student competitors!”
Karen Ruggles, DeSales University varsity esports program director, closed the event with a talk that channeled the day’s excitement into a reflection on the future of esports—encouraging attendees to recognize how gaming, competition, and community can fuel personal and professional growth, while inspiring them to embrace their individual potential to shape a thriving, positive future for the industry.
The event received overwhelmingly positive feedback from attendees, sponsors, and students alike. Educators and parents praised the organization and valuable insights shared, sponsors appreciated the meaningful engagement, and students were energized by the high-level competition and community-centered atmosphere.
The CCIU Events Team and PSEL Esports Team is already planning for the next event and looks forward to bringing esports colleagues together again soon.

With the fall semester around the corner, NIU Esports has made several changes and additions to make this semester at the Esports Arena more exciting than ever before.
NIU ESPORTS DIRECTOR CONNER VAGLE RESIGNS
The most significant change for the program is the resignation of Conner Vagle, former director of NIU Esports, which was made effective on July 24. Vagle made the official announcement of his departure on the NIU Esports Discord server on July 15.
Vagle stated in his announcement that he’s accepted a new opportunity in the more traditional side of sports as the reason for his resignation.
“Even before accepting my role with NIU, I’ve always envisioned esports as being a natural pathway to traditional sports and I’m truly excited to be able to act on this belief,” Vagle said in a post on NIU Esports’ Discord server.
Vagle held much admiration and trust toward NIU and the community that supported him. As former director, his presence will be missed, but the change will give rise to new leadership and interesting plans for the program going forward. There has been no announcement as to who will take Vagle’s position as director at this time.
NEW VARSITY ESPORTS TITLE
“Super Smash Bros. Ultimate” will be championed as a new esports varsity title starting in the fall 2025 semester. In becoming a varsity title, players will be competing against other universities in the Esports Collegiate Conference with scheduled practices and matches to look forward to. This game will function as the first fighting game to join NIU’s Esports program, as well as the first solo esport, unlike the team-based format of games like “Valorant” and “League of Legends.”
As of July 30, NIU Esports staff have begun the interview process for potential candidates for the coaching position in preparation of its announcement. Plans to begin drafting players for the varsity league as well as the schedule for the season have yet to be announced. For those eager for future updates about this title, students can join a mailing list or the NIU Esports Discord server on the NIU Esports webpage.
NIU RETURNS TO HOST IHSEA STATE FINALS
Another highlight is the continuation of the partnership between the Illinois High School Esports Association and NIU.
IHSEA is a non-profit esports program for high schools in Illinois that provides educational resources and experiences for high schoolers to learn and participate in the esports field. Successful alumni of their program can also earn college varsity scholarships in their future, as well as potential careers in the industry.
NIU will continue to host the state finals for the program, and is anticipating great things from this partnership. Detailed information about the event has not been given at this time. Future information about the dates of the events, as well as the games that will be played will be announced at a later date.
NEW VARSITY SEASON, NEW CHANCES FOR SUCCESS
With the fall semester beginning, the varsity seasons for Valorant and Rocket League will commence, and the competitive spirit for the championship is more present than ever.
NIU’s two teams, for Valorant and Rocket League respectively, will face off in the Esports Collegiate Conference, or ESC, as part of a semester-long series of matches that will allow them to qualify for the playoff season in the later months.
Anticipating spectators of these competitions can watch these matches broadcasted on the NIU Esports Twitch channel.
GAMING RETURNS TO ALTGELD HALL
A new semester means the re-opening of Altgeld Hall’s Esports Arena. While the arena itself has been open for free play and esports activities since March 2022, the summer months have brought new games awaiting for students to play them at NIU this semester.
Additionally, events led by student organizations, such as the Huskie Gaming Club, will continue to take place as well. The Huskie Gaming Club holds their events at 5 p.m. every Friday, with the organization announcing their planned games in the Huskie Gaming Discord server. Those interested in joining the server can do so on the Huskie Gaming Club webpage.
The Esports Arena will be free for all students using their OneCard and will allow for free play with the equipment provided by the arena.

MUMBAI: Katalyst Sports, a division of Katalyst Entertainment has announced the appointment of Mahesh Kumar as its new VP – Alliances and Operations. Mahesh brings with him over 23 years of experience in events, sports production, and brand partnerships.
Katalyst Sports is focussed on creating sports IPs, athlete-led fan experiences, and brand-led alliances that redefine how India engages with live sports.
Before joining Katalyst Sports, Mahesh held senior leadership roles including Head – Events & Operations at LegaXy, and Head – Productions and Operations at Legends League Cricket, where he played a pivotal role in scaling high-impact sports events across India and overseas. His previous stints include Fountainhead MKTG, Wizcraft International Entertainment, and other marquee agencies, contributing to some of the country’s most iconic sports and entertainment properties.
In his new role at Katalyst Sports, he will lead strategic alliances, operations, and end-to-end execution across sporting IPs, brand partnerships, and live experiences.
Nitin Arora, founder, CEO, Katalyst Entertainment said, “Mahesh’s deep domain expertise and stellar track record in operations and alliance building make him a valuable addition to the Katalyst leadership team. As we scale our ambitions in the sports and live entertainment space, his insights and executional strength will be instrumental in driving impact at scale.”
Kumar said, “I am thrilled to be part of the dynamic and fast-growing ecosystem at Katalyst Sports. The vision here aligns perfectly with my passion for creating seamless, large-format experiences that bring fans, brands, and athletes closer than ever before. I look forward to building and scaling exciting new formats with the team.”
